I'm assuming you are trying to empty the windows print spool cache.

If that is the case, you need to stop the print spooler service, empty the cache, then restart the print spooler service.

The exact steps vary by Windows version, if you need more help, I'd need to know which version of windows you are using.

I have a new computer with windows 7 premium 64 bit and a hp psc 750xi all in one printer how do i get the drivers to have my printer work

  1. Navigate to the HP website. http://www.hp.com.au
  2. Click on the Support and Drivers section, located at the top right of the page.
  3. In the for product field - type in: HP PSC 750xi All-in-One Printer. Press <Enter>.
  4. Click the Software and Drivers Download link.
  5. Click the link Microsoft Windows 7 (64 bit).
  6. Click on the link that says, Installing the Product with the USB cable ...
  7. Here you will find HP's solution to the problem.
Note: HP have not updated their drivers for this printer for use with Windows 7. You will be able to get basic functionality from your printer, but not all of the features of your printer. You may wish to shop around for another printer. If you do, make sure you check what systems the printer works on (i.e., xp, vista, windows7) etc...

How do I access the ink jets?

You must open up the printer. The lift point is in the front between the paper output and glass scanning surface. You should see and indent there . When you lift it up (it does weigh a slight bit), the printer heads should move to the access position. There is a lever on top of each cartridge to unlock it front the carrage.
